Understanding the Skullcandy Hesh 3
Before we dive into the mic question, let’s take a closer look at the Skullcandy Hesh 3. This headphone model is part of Skullcandy’s Hesh series, which is known for its high-quality sound, comfortable design, and durable construction. The Hesh 3 is a wireless headphone that offers a range of features, including:
- Up to 22 hours of battery life
- Wireless connectivity via Bluetooth 4.0
- 40mm drivers for clear and balanced sound
- Soft, synthetic ear cushions for comfort
- Folding design for easy storage and transport
Does the Skullcandy Hesh 3 Have a Mic?
Now, let’s get to the question at hand: does the Skullcandy Hesh 3 have a mic? The answer is yes, the Skullcandy Hesh 3 does come with a built-in microphone. This mic is designed to provide clear and crisp audio for phone calls, voice chats, and voice commands.
Microphone Specifications
The Skullcandy Hesh 3’s microphone is a single-channel, omnidirectional mic that’s designed to pick up sound from all directions. This type of mic is ideal for phone calls and voice chats, as it can capture the user’s voice clearly and accurately.
Here are some key specifications of the Skullcandy Hesh 3’s microphone:
- Frequency response: 100 Hz – 10 kHz
- Sensitivity: -42 dB ± 3 dB
- Impedance: 2.2 kΩ

Is the Skullcandy Hesh 3’s microphone noise-cancelling?
The Skullcandy Hesh 3’s microphone is not noise-cancelling in the classical sense. However, the headphones do feature a closed-back design, which can help block out background noise and reduce ambient sound. This can help improve the microphone’s performance in noisy environments.
That being said, the Hesh 3 does not feature active noise-cancelling technology, which is a separate feature that uses one or more microphones to actively cancel out background noise. If you’re looking for a headphone with active noise-cancelling, you may want to consider a different model.
